How much do bio anal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for bio analyst in Seattle, WA is $86,801.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$65,400.00 and $102,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a bio analyst?

Bio Analysts are professionals who analyze biological samples and data to assist in scientific research, clinical diagnostics, or product development. They work in laboratories, using advanced equipment and techniques to study cells, tissues, or biomolecules. Bio Analysts may also interpret results, prepare reports, and ensure quality control. Their work is essential in healthcare, p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, and environmental science. A strong background in biology, chemistry, and data analysis is typically required.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a bio anal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Bio Analyst, you need a solid background in biology, chemistry, and data analysis, typically supported by a degree in life sciences or a related field. Experience with laboratory equipment, statistical analysis software (such as R or SPSS), and familiarity with quality control protocols are commonly required.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help you interpret complex data and collaborate with research teams. These skills are crucial for ensuring accurate analysis, maintaining data integrity, and supporting scientific advancements.

What are some typical challenges a bio analyst faces when working with large biological datasets?

Bio Analysts frequently work with vast and complex datasets, which can present challenges such as data quality issues, incomplete records, and the need for advanced computational tools to process and interpret results. Collaborating closely with data scientists, laboratory technicians, and researchers is essential to ensure accurate data analysis and meaningful insights. Staying updated on software advancements and maintaining strong communication skills are also important in navigating these common obstacles.

What is the difference between Bio Analyst vs Laboratory Technician?

The main difference between a Bio Analyst and a Laboratory Technician lies in their roles and qualifications. Bio Analysts typically hold a bachelor's degree and focus on analyzing biological data, conducting research, and interpreting results. Laboratory Technicians often have technical training and assist with routine lab procedures and sample processing. Both roles work in similar environments but differ in responsibilities and educational requirements.
